Industry Background and Market Demand

Metal casting remains a cornerstone in industries such as automotive, aerospace, heavy machinery, and energy. After casting, residual sand adheres to the surface, requiring efficient removal to maintain dimensional accuracy, surface quality, and downstream process efficiency. Traditional methods, such as manual brushing or low-efficiency tumblers, are labor-intensive, inconsistent, and often damage the casting surface.

With increasing demand for high-volume production and superior product quality, foundries require automated solutions that reliably remove sand without affecting casting integrity. Vibratory sand shedding machines have emerged as a critical technology to meet these industrial needs, combining speed, consistency, and safety.

Core Concepts and Key Technologies

A vibratory sand shedding machine utilizes high-frequency vibration to dislodge residual sand from metal castings. By transmitting controlled mechanical energy through a vibrating tray or frame, the machine separates sand while leaving the casting intact. Adjustable vibration frequency and amplitude allow operators to optimize performance for different casting weights, sizes, and sand types.

Key technological features often include:

  • Precision Vibrators or Exciters: Generate controlled motion for uniform sand removal.

  • Programmable Controls: Adjust cycle duration, frequency, and amplitude for specific casting types.

  • Dust Management Systems: Integrated extraction units minimize airborne particles, improving workplace safety and environmental compliance.

Product Structure, Performance, and Manufacturing Considerations

A typical vibratory sand shedding machine consists of:

  • Vibrating Tray or Conveyor: Supports castings and transmits vibration to remove sand.

  • Heavy-Duty Frame: Constructed from wear-resistant steel to withstand continuous vibration.

  • Excitation System: Electric motors or hydraulic actuators that drive oscillation.

  • Screening or Sorting Layer (Optional): Captures larger sand particles for recycling or disposal.

  • Control Panel: Allows operators to customize settings according to production requirements.

Performance metrics include sand removal efficiency, cycle time, throughput, energy consumption, and vibration stability. High-quality materials, precision welding, and reinforced structures ensure long-term durability and minimal maintenance requirements.

Key Factors Affecting Sand Removal Quality

The efficiency and consistency of sand shedding are influenced by several factors:

  • Casting Geometry: Complex cavities or thin walls may retain sand, requiring tailored vibration patterns.

  • Sand Composition: Grain size, moisture content, and binder type affect separation behavior.

  • Load Distribution: Even placement of castings ensures uniform sand removal.

  • Vibration Parameters: Incorrect frequency or amplitude can reduce efficiency or damage the casting.

  • Maintenance and Wear: Worn components or misaligned systems diminish performance over time.

Proper configuration, routine inspection, and preventive maintenance are critical to maintaining optimal sand shedding performance.

Common Industry Challenges and Pain Points

Despite automation, sand shedding presents several challenges:

  • Incomplete Sand Removal: Residual sand may affect machining, heat treatment, or surface finishing.

  • Casting Damage: Excessive vibration or improper fixture support can lead to cracks or deformation.

  • Dust and Noise Pollution: High-frequency vibration generates dust and noise, requiring mitigation.

  • Maintenance Requirements: Components exposed to constant vibration are subject to wear and require regular inspection.

Modern machines address these issues through precision engineering, controlled vibration, and integrated dust collection systems.

Application Scenarios and Industry Use Cases

Vibratory sand shedding machines are widely employed in:

  • Automotive Foundries: Cleaning engine blocks, cylinder heads, and transmission housings.

  • Heavy Machinery Production: Removing sand from large steel or iron castings used in construction equipment.

  • Aluminum and Non-Ferrous Foundries: Preparing surfaces for machining, anodizing, or painting.

  • Continuous Production Lines: Integrating with conveyors, decoring machines, or surface finishing systems for seamless operations.

These machines improve throughput, reduce labor costs, and ensure consistent product quality across high-volume production lines.

Current Trends and Future Development

The foundry industry is increasingly adopting automation, energy efficiency, and environmental sustainability. Current trends include:

  • Smart Controls: Programmable vibration parameters and real-time monitoring for optimal performance.

  • Energy-Efficient Drives: Reduce power consumption without compromising sand removal quality.

  • Dust and Noise Reduction Systems: Improve compliance with workplace safety and environmental regulations.

  • Integration with Industry 4.0: Sensor-based monitoring, predictive maintenance, and data-driven process optimization.

Future advancements may focus on adaptive vibration systems that automatically adjust parameters for different casting types, improving efficiency while minimizing casting stress and operational costs.
